This completely revised and updated edition of the classic text describes and analyzes every movie made by Hitchcock. In chronological order, Spoto describes and analyzes the craft, style and intent of all of Hitchcock's movies, including the little-known silent ones made at the beginning of his career. Contains a storyboard section that illustrates the director's technical skills. Includes photographs, filmography, bibliography, and index.

Donald Spoto is the author of 25 books, including bestselling biographies of Alfred Hitchcock, Tennessee Williams, Laurence Olivier, Marlene Dietrich, Ingrid Bergman, and Audrey Hepburn. He earned his PhD degree from Fordham University. Spoto is married to the Danish school administrator Ole Flemming Larsen; they live in a quiet village, an hour's drive from Copenhagen.
